[Python-checkins] CVS: python/dist/src/Mac/Lib/Carbon MacTextEditor.py,1.1,1.2

Jack Jansen jackjansen@users.sourceforge.net
Fri, 04 Jan 2002 08:01:25 -0800


Update of /cvsroot/python/python/dist/src/Mac/Lib/Carbon
In directory usw-pr-cvs1:/tmp/cvs-serv18024/Python/Mac/Lib/Carbon

Modified Files:
	MacTextEditor.py 
Log Message:
UH 3.4 checkin that I had forgotten about.

Index: MacTextEditor.py
===================================================================
RCS file: /cvsroot/python/python/dist/src/Mac/Lib/Carbon/MacTextEditor.py,v
retrieving revision 1.1
retrieving revision 1.2
diff -C2 -d -r1.1 -r1.2
*** MacTextEditor.py	2001/08/19 22:11:57	1.1
--- MacTextEditor.py	2002/01/04 16:01:23	1.2
***************
*** 37,40 ****
--- 37,44 ----
  kTXNDoNotInstallDragProcsBit = 10
  kTXNAlwaysWrapAtViewEdgeBit = 11
+ kTXNDontDrawCaretWhenInactiveBit = 12
+ kTXNDontDrawSelectionWhenInactiveBit = 13
+ kTXNSingleLineOnlyBit = 14
+ kTXNDisableDragAndDropBit = 15
  kTXNDrawGrowIconMask = 1L << kTXNDrawGrowIconBit
  kTXNShowWindowMask = 1L << kTXNShowWindowBit
***************
*** 49,52 ****
--- 53,74 ----
  kTXNDoNotInstallDragProcsMask = 1L << kTXNDoNotInstallDragProcsBit
  kTXNAlwaysWrapAtViewEdgeMask = 1L << kTXNAlwaysWrapAtViewEdgeBit
+ kTXNDontDrawCaretWhenInactiveMask = 1L << kTXNDontDrawCaretWhenInactiveBit
+ kTXNDontDrawSelectionWhenInactiveMask = 1L << kTXNDontDrawSelectionWhenInactiveBit
+ kTXNSingleLineOnlyMask = 1L << kTXNSingleLineOnlyBit
+ kTXNDisableDragAndDropMask = 1L << kTXNDisableDragAndDropBit
+ kTXNSetFlushnessBit = 0
+ kTXNSetJustificationBit = 1
+ kTXNUseFontFallBackBit = 2
+ kTXNRotateTextBit = 3
+ kTXNUseVerticalTextBit = 4
+ kTXNDontUpdateBoxRectBit = 5
+ kTXNDontDrawTextBit = 6
+ kTXNSetFlushnessMask = 1L << kTXNSetFlushnessBit
+ kTXNSetJustificationMask = 1L << kTXNSetJustificationBit
+ kTXNUseFontFallBackMask = 1L << kTXNUseFontFallBackBit
+ kTXNRotateTextMask = 1L << kTXNRotateTextBit
+ kTXNUseVerticalTextMask = 1L << kTXNUseVerticalTextBit
+ kTXNDontUpdateBoxRectMask = 1L << kTXNDontUpdateBoxRectBit
+ kTXNDontDrawTextMask = 1L << kTXNDontDrawTextBit
  kTXNFontContinuousBit = 0
  kTXNSizeContinuousBit = 1
***************
*** 62,72 ****
  kTXNIgnoreCaseMask = 1L << kTXNIgnoreCaseBit
  kTXNEntireWordMask = 1L << kTXNEntireWordBit
! kTXNUseEncodingWordRulesMask = 1L << kTXNUseEncodingWordRulesBit
  kTXNTextensionFile = FOUR_CHAR_CODE('txtn')
  kTXNTextFile = FOUR_CHAR_CODE('TEXT')
  kTXNPictureFile = FOUR_CHAR_CODE('PICT')
! kTXNMovieFile = MovieFileType
  kTXNSoundFile = FOUR_CHAR_CODE('sfil')
  kTXNAIFFFile = FOUR_CHAR_CODE('AIFF')
  kTXNTextEditStyleFrameType = 1
  kTXNPageFrameType = 2
--- 84,95 ----
  kTXNIgnoreCaseMask = 1L << kTXNIgnoreCaseBit
  kTXNEntireWordMask = 1L << kTXNEntireWordBit
! kTXNUseEncodingWordRulesMask = (unsigned long)(1L << kTXNUseEncodingWordRulesBit)
  kTXNTextensionFile = FOUR_CHAR_CODE('txtn')
  kTXNTextFile = FOUR_CHAR_CODE('TEXT')
  kTXNPictureFile = FOUR_CHAR_CODE('PICT')
! kTXNMovieFile = FOUR_CHAR_CODE('MooV')
  kTXNSoundFile = FOUR_CHAR_CODE('sfil')
  kTXNAIFFFile = FOUR_CHAR_CODE('AIFF')
+ kTXNUnicodeTextFile = FOUR_CHAR_CODE('utxt')
  kTXNTextEditStyleFrameType = 1
  kTXNPageFrameType = 2
***************
*** 88,92 ****
--- 111,121 ----
  kTXNRefConTag = FOUR_CHAR_CODE('rfcn')
  kTXNMarginsTag = FOUR_CHAR_CODE('marg')
+ kTXNFlattenMoviesTag = FOUR_CHAR_CODE('flat')
+ kTXNDoFontSubstitution = FOUR_CHAR_CODE('fSub')
  kTXNNoUserIOTag = FOUR_CHAR_CODE('nuio')
+ kTXNUseCarbonEvents = FOUR_CHAR_CODE('cbcb')
+ kTXNDrawCaretWhenInactiveTag = FOUR_CHAR_CODE('dcrt')
+ kTXNDrawSelectionWhenInactiveTag = FOUR_CHAR_CODE('dsln')
+ kTXNDisableDragAndDropTag = FOUR_CHAR_CODE('drag')
  kTXNTypingAction = 0
  kTXNCutAction = 1
***************
*** 104,108 ****
  kTXNFontFeatureAction = 13
  kTXNFontVariationAction = 14
! kTXNUndoLastAction = 1024                          
  # kTXNClearThisControl = (long)0xFFFFFFFF
  # kTXNClearTheseFontFeatures = (long)0x80000000
--- 133,137 ----
  kTXNFontFeatureAction = 13
  kTXNFontVariationAction = 14
! kTXNUndoLastAction = 1024  
  # kTXNClearThisControl = (long)0xFFFFFFFF
  # kTXNClearTheseFontFeatures = (long)0x80000000
***************
*** 119,122 ****
--- 148,157 ----
  kTXNAutoIndentOff = false
  kTXNAutoIndentOn = true
+ kTXNDontDrawCaretWhenInactive = false
+ kTXNDrawCaretWhenInactive = true
+ kTXNDontDrawSelectionWhenInactive = false
+ kTXNDrawSelectionWhenInactive = true
+ kTXNEnableDragAndDrop = false
+ kTXNDisableDragAndDrop = true
  kTXNRightTab = -1
  kTXNLeftTab = 0
***************
*** 129,133 ****
  kTXNCenter = 4
  kTXNFullJust = 8
! kTXNForceFullJust = 16                            
  kScrollBarsAlwaysActive = true
  kScrollBarsSyncWithFocus = false
--- 164,168 ----
  kTXNCenter = 4
  kTXNFullJust = 8
! kTXNForceFullJust = 16    
  kScrollBarsAlwaysActive = true
  kScrollBarsSyncWithFocus = false
***************
*** 136,139 ****
--- 171,176 ----
  kTXNIncrementTypeSize = 0x00000001
  # kTXNDecrementTypeSize = (long)0x80000000
+ kTXNUseScriptDefaultValue = -1
+ kTXNNoFontVariations = 0x7FFF
  # kTXNUseCurrentSelection = 0xFFFFFFFFUL
  # kTXNStartOffset = 0UL
***************
*** 157,164 ****
--- 194,211 ----
  # kTXNQDFontColorAttributeSize = sizeof(RGBColor)
  # kTXNTextEncodingAttributeSize = sizeof(TextEncoding)
+ kTXNFontSizeAttributeSize = sizeof(Fixed)
  kTXNSystemDefaultEncoding = 0
  kTXNMacOSEncoding = 1
  kTXNUnicodeEncoding = 2
  kTXNBackgroundTypeRGB = 1
+ kTXNTextInputCountBit = 0
+ kTXNRunCountBit = 1
+ kTXNTextInputCountMask = 1L << kTXNTextInputCountBit
+ kTXNRunCountMask = 1L << kTXNRunCountBit
+ kTXNAllCountMask = kTXNTextInputCountMask | kTXNRunCountMask
+ kTXNNoAppleEventHandlersBit = 0
+ kTXNRestartAppleEventHandlersBit = 1
+ kTXNNoAppleEventHandlersMask = 1 << kTXNNoAppleEventHandlersBit
+ kTXNRestartAppleEventHandlersMask = 1 << kTXNRestartAppleEventHandlersBit
  # status = TXNInitTextension( &defaults
  # justification = LMTESysJust